[ ] Step 7 — Recover the transcode signing key. After the Brindlecast farm's HSM quorum is confirmed (three of five custodians present, Meers presiding), you will re-seed the encoder signing chain. Insert the ceremony card into the offline terminal in the Halloway annex, select "restore", and wait for the amber light. The terminal will then ask for the recovery passphrase held by the junior custodian — that's you. Type it in one line, no trailing space. The passphrase is reproduced below for this ceremony only.

vault phrase of bagaf-kajeg = jorath-feniel-briir-siliel-ralix

Subject: Driftwood UI kit — versioning, please actually read this

Future maintainers, hi. The Driftwood component library now follows strict semver, for real this time. Breaking prop changes bump the major, new components bump the minor, and visual-only tweaks are patches. Consumers pin to major ranges, so a sloppy bump breaks three downstream apps at Thornlea alone.

The changelog generator reads commit prefixes — use them or the release script refuses to tag. Each published version records its build token, shown below for this release.

pipeline stamp: htk6_7941f2

Subject: On-call handover — CSV import wizard

Hi Tomas,

Handing over the Velbridge CSV import wizard pager. Known issue: uploads over 20MB intermittently stall at the column-mapping step; workaround is to split the file and retry. A fix is queued for the Thursday deploy. Two open tickets from the Marstow retail team are tagged 'import-stall' — please watch those. Logs are under the importer dashboard, filter by job ID. If anything escalates beyond tier two, route it to the importer squad inbox.

escalation mailbox, yajeg-bageg: quenax.olidor@lumiccorp.internal

### Action Item 3 — Watchdog restart loop

So the Perchboard kiosk watchdog did its job a little too well during the outage — it kept restarting the app every 20 seconds, which wiped session state and made customers start over mid-order. The fix in this PR adds a backoff cap and a "degraded but alive" state the watchdog tolerates. Reviewer: please check the state machine carefully, especially the transition out of degraded mode. The agreed behavior and the diagram we sketched in the retro are written up here.

operations page: https://confluence.tolvaqsys.corp/spaces/pages/pages/6e787158f507